Java.rmi.AccessException: Registry.Registry.rebind disallowed
I am getting the following error while creating a client socket. I am not exactly sure what is causing the problem.
This is happening on windows 2k3 sp2 French dual stack machine.
java.rmi.AccessException: Registry.Registry.rebind disallowed; origin /fe80:0:0:0:219:b9ff:fe00:d81d is non-local host:java.rmi.AccessException: Registry.Registry.rebind disallowed; origin /fe80:0:0:0:219:b9ff:fe00:d81d is non-local host
And also I observed the server socket is something different to the normal one ..
ServerSocket[addr=::/0:0:0:0:0:0:0:0,port=0,localport=11501
Normally it will be 0.0.0.0/0.0.0.0. I don't know why it is different....
Any pointers why I am getting that exception and the server socket is =::/0:0:0:0:0:0:0:0?
Edited by: shash10 on Jun 9, 2008 12:07 AM
Edited by: shash10 on Jun 9, 2008 12:36 AMI am getting the following error while creating a client socket.No, you're getting it while calling Registry.rebind(), because you're doing that from a client that isn't on the same host as the Registry, and that's illegal, as the exception text says. Nothing to do with IPv6 actually.
